The Emperor of Ocean Park is an upcoming American mystery suspense thriller television series based on Stephen L. Carter's novel of the same name. It is set to premiere on July 14, 2024 on MGM+.

Premise[edit]

Set in the worlds of politics, Ivy League academia and the beaches of Martha's Vineyard, the series follows a law professor whose quiet life is shattered when his father dies of an apparent heart attack. The nature of the judge's death is questioned by a former journalist and inveterate conspiracy theorist. She believes a failed Black nominee to the Supreme Court met with foul play.

Production[edit]

Development[edit]

In January 2023, MGM+ began developing a series based on Stephen L. Carter's best-selling novel, with Sherman Payne writing several episodes and Damian Marcano set to direct.[1] The series was produced by John Wells Productions and Warner Bros. Television.[1]

In April 2023, it was announced that the pay channel had ordered ten episodes of the series.[2] Producer Llewellyn Wells was later signed on in January 2024.[3]

Casting[edit]

In November 2023, It was announced that Grantham Coleman would star in the lead role, Tiffany Mack and Paulina Lule also star. Later on, Forest Whitaker join the cast in January 2024.[4][5] Henry Simmons, Bryan Greenberg and Jasmine Batchelor join the cast, as well as with Ora Jones and Torrey Hanson joined the cast in February 2024.[6]

Filming[edit]

Principal photography began in Chicago on January 10, 2024 and wrapped on April 25.[6]
